Curriculum content descriptions

Develop, modify and communicate design ideas by applying design thinking, creativity, innovation and enterprise skills of increasing sophistication  (ACTDEP049)

Elaborations
  • using techniques including combining and modifying ideas and exploring functionality to generate solution concepts
  • undertaking functional, structural and aesthetic analyses of benefits and constraints of design ideas, for example to different communities and environments including those from the countries of Asia
  • re-imagining designs to feature emerging technologies
  • considering competing variables that may hinder or enhance project development, for example weight, strength and price; laws; social protocols and community consultation processes
  • producing drawings, models and prototypes to explore design ideas, for example using technical drawing techniques, digital imaging programs, 3D printers or augmented reality modelling software; producing multiple prototypes that show an understanding of key aesthetic considerations in competing designs
  • communicating using appropriate technical terms and recording the generation and development of design ideas for an intended audience including justification of decisions, for example developing a digital portfolio with images and text which clearly communicates each step of a design process
